Hi Arek,

On Mon, Nov 8, 2010 at 1:10 AM, Arek Stefański <asmaged...@gmail.com> wrote:
> Hey, I thought Unladen Swallow is dead.
> Sure seems close to this.
> It's really cool project, why is it so 'abandoned' right now? :<

Jeffrey and I have been pulled on to other projects of higher
importance to Google. Unfortunately, no-one from the Python
open-source community has been interested in picking up the merger
work, and since none of the original team is still full-time on the
project, it's moving very slowly. Finishing up the merger into the
py3k-jit branch is a high priority for me this quarter, but what
happens then is an open question.

Hey Gary,

On Tue, Nov 9, 2010 at 9:48 AM, garyrob <grobin...@flyfi.com> wrote:
>> Finishing up the merger into the
>> py3k-jit branch is a high priority for me this quarter, but what
>> happens then is an open question.

> Does that mean there is no longer a commitment to merging the JIT into
> Python 3.2 -- or are you saying that WILL be done this quarter?

I need to get the code from the Unladen Swallow repository moved into
the python.org svn repo's py3k-jit branch. There are still a number of
issues that need work before final merger into Python 3.x is approved;
the final merger is contingent on resolving the remaining issues in
PEP 3146. The Python community will need to help resolve these
problems.
